Are There Giraffes at Disney World?

Published in Disney Animals 2 mins read

Yes, giraffes are indeed present at Walt Disney World Resort, offering guests unique opportunities to observe these majestic animals.

Giraffes can be found in multiple locations within Disney World, providing different types of viewing experiences for visitors.

Where to See Giraffes at Walt Disney World

The primary locations to encounter giraffes are within Disney's Animal Kingdom theme park and at the adjacent Disney's Animal Kingdom Lodge.

Disney's Animal Kingdom Theme Park

At Disney's Animal Kingdom theme park, guests can embark on the popular Kilimanjaro Safaris attraction. This immersive expedition takes visitors on an open-air vehicle ride through vast savannas, replicating an African wildlife reserve. Here, giraffes roam freely alongside other savanna animals like zebras, rhinos, and antelopes, offering a realistic and thrilling safari experience.

Disney's Animal Kingdom Lodge

For an even more up-close and personal encounter, giraffes also graze the savannas at Disney's Animal Kingdom Lodge. This unique resort hotel is designed with sprawling savannas that are home to over 30 species of African wildlife, including giraffes. Guests staying in savanna-view rooms or visiting the public viewing areas of the lodge can enjoy the incredible sight of giraffes, zebras, and other animals wandering just outside. It's an unparalleled opportunity to observe these magnificent creatures right from the comfort of the resort.
